shots

shotsplural of shot

/ʃɒt/

noun

strzał

/stʂaw/· rzeczownik
Also
zdjęcie(n)kieliszek(m)
Definition

The act of firing a gun or a single attempt to score in sports; also, a small drink of alcohol or a photograph.

Examples
He heard a distant shot in the woods.
Usłyszał odległy strzał w lesie.
That was a great shot by the photographer.
To było świetne zdjęcie wykonane przez fotografa.
He ordered a shot of espresso.
Zamówił kieliszek espresso.
Synonyms
blastattemptpicture
Collocations
warning shotlong shottake a shot

adjective

wykończony

/vɨkɔɲˈt͡ʂɔnɨ/· przymiotnik
Also
zniszczony
Definition

Damaged or ruined, often by being worn out or exhausted.

Examples
My old car's engine is completely shot.
Silnik mojego starego samochodu jest całkowicie wykończony.
After working all night, I feel absolutely shot.
Po pracy przez całą noc czuję się absolutnie wykończony.
Synonyms
exhaustedruinedworn out
Collocations
shot nervesshot to pieces
